HOBAN, P. J., December 30, 1954.
Since summary judgment as permitted by Pa. R. C. P. 1098 is entered in these proceedings, rather than a formal adjudication and judgment nisi under the usual nonjury trial procedure, it seems proper to state of record the reasons for the action taken.
